
About Yulia Perez-Caballero
Yulia Perez-Caballero grew up passionate about law and pursued a deeply international legal education. She earned her B.A. in Psychology from the University of Puerto Rico in 2016, studied comparative law at the Communication University of China in 2017, and attended the University of Bologna's Human Rights in the European Union program in 2018. She earned her J.D. from the Inter American University School of Law in Puerto Rico in 2019 and completed additional studies in International Cyber Conflicts (SUNY 2020) and FinTech Law and Policy (Duke University 2020). Her earlier experience includes roles as an Investigation Mediation Assistant at New Jersey City University and an Investigation Assistant at the Caribbean Centre of Human Rights. She is admitted to the Georgia Bar and the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Georgia.
